Waste-to-Energy Technologies



With waste generation increasing, finding sustainable solutions is becoming progressively vital. Waste-to-Energy (WtE) technologies provide a promising strategy to handling our waste while producing power. These modern technologies involve converting non-recyclable waste products right into functional forms of energy like power, warmth, or gas.



By diverting waste from garbage dumps and blazing it in regulated settings, WtE not just decreases the volume of waste but also generates beneficial power sources.

One common method of WtE is mass-burn incineration, where waste is shed at high temperatures to generate heavy steam that drives generators generating power. One more approach is gasification, which converts waste right into synthetic gas that can be used for power generation or as a chemical feedstock.

Additionally, anaerobic digestion breaks down organic waste to generate biogas for energy.

Executing WtE innovations can help reduce greenhouse gas emissions, lower dependence on nonrenewable fuel sources, and lessen the ecological influence of waste disposal.
